    What is a single-serve coffee maker?

    A single coffee maker is a small appliance that can brew just one cup of fresh, flavorful tea or coffee at any time. They're typically fast and easy to use, and come with a range of options. They may cost more upfront than a standard brewer, but a lot of consumers find that they save enough on the cost of purchasing coffee and tea from the coffee shop to pay back their initial investment fast.

    Most models of single-serve coffee makers use pre-packaged coffee pods or "K-Cups" and tea bags to brew either soft or hard (adhesive-free) pods made of filter paper or plastic capsules containing whole or ground coffee. They may also come with an open drawer for loose tea and some come with a drawer that holds hot water for making iced coffee or hot chocolate. Some even make espresso for those who like caffeinated drinks on occasion.

    For people who prefer a more traditional brewed cup of coffee, several models can be used to make drip-style coffee like a French press or moka pot. Other models are able to make espresso-style coffee, lattes and cappuccinos using an additional add-on or milk frother. Additionally to that, some of the most advanced brewers can also dispense hot water to fill a travel mug for on-the-go tea or coffee.

    How do I select a single coffee machine?

    A single-serve coffee maker is the ideal method of making a cup of coffee at the click of a button. The Good Housekeeping Institute Kitchen Appliances and Innovation Lab has tested various of these devices and found that they are more effective than ever in making delicious coffee. When selecting a model it's crucial to consider a number of factors.

    The first thing you need to think about is what type of brew you'd like make. A lot of single-serve machines can only brew a cup of coffee at a time, however some can also make tea, espresso, or hot chocolate. Certain machines can also brew lattes or cappuccinos if you choose the right pods or capsules.

    Another factor to consider is the amount of money you're willing to spend. A single-serve machine may cost more upfront than a standard brewer, but it will save you money in the end by avoiding costly coffee shop purchases. Be sure to include cost of the coffees or teas that you plan to brew in your calculations.

    You'll also have to decide whether you're comfortable producing waste from these devices. The good news is that the majority of models now have reusable, recyclable, or compostable options for their pods and K-Cups, so you can help cut down on the amount of plastic that is in your home.

    It is best to choose a single-serve machine that is a good fit for your preferences and lifestyle. If you want to keep your machine clean and healthy then choose a model which is easy to clean. If you'd like to control more of the coffee you drink, consider a machine that lets you grind your own beans.

    Which single coffee machine is right for me

    There are many ways to make coffee at home, and each offers its own pros and cons. Single-serve coffee makers are the best option for those who want convenience, but without sacrificing taste. Like the name suggests, these machines produce only one cup at a time, and take up less counter space than their larger counterparts. They also have a the ability to brew faster which means that you could enjoy your morning coffee within 30 seconds.

    As we all know, however the fact is that not all machines are made to be the same. It is crucial to consider the type of coffee you like and the frequency you intend to use your machine before making a purchase. If you like the flavor of a smooth latte then a pod machine made by brands like Keurig or Nespresso will be the ideal choice for you. If you'd prefer more control over the taste of your morning coffee, the French press and coffee grinder might be the better choice.

    Another factor to consider is how much upkeep you're willing to commit to. While most models on the market need little maintenance beyond a routine rinse and wiping Some need to be descaled at least once every six months. This process removes any minerals from the water, which could affect the brewing temperature and quality. The company must either provide instructions or include them in the instruction manual, depending on the model.

    Before you make a final decision, take into consideration the aspects that are most important to you. You should consider the amount of counter space available, and whether the dimension of the machine you select will require more or less space than the other options.
